Appositives!!
(It sounds fancy, but it's not really!!) (You've got this!!)
2
Saying that there's an "appositive" is a fancy way of saying you're identifying or explaining a noun.
And we all know a noun is a person, place, thing, or idea.
3
An appositive will ALWAYS come after the noun it identifies or explains.
Literally 100% of the time.
Usually, it is the word RIGHT IN FRONT of the appositive.

One problem....
What does an appositive look like in a sentence? Let's look at a sentence and see if we can figure it out.
6
Nosferatu, a vampire in the Krusty Krab, is switching the lights on and off to scare Spongebob.
Where is the appositive?
7
What do we notice about the appositive?
It immediately follows the noun it identifies (Nosferatu).
It is separated by COMMAS.
The commas show that the appositive is extra information. We don't need it, but it makes our sentences sound better.

What do we need to remember?
Appositives identify or explain a noun. They offer more information
They ALWAYS, 100% OF THE TIME follow the noun they identify or explain.
They are separated from the rest of the sentence by a set of commas.
They're not as complicated as they sound, but now you know a fancy word for it!!
